Beetle by Nancy McGihon - Nancy tells us that she wanted to reflect some of the organic forms in the fabric.  She made leaf-like designs on the background, scaly-like stitches on the limbs of the beetle and she echoed the strips on the border.  We love it Nancy!  Great job!
